### Account Recovery — Catalogue Import (Lintwood)

Quick one for review: when the Lintwood catalogue import wipes a patron's session table, the recovery flow re-seeds accounts from the nightly snapshot. Check that the importer skips locked accounts — last time it didn't. To rerun recovery against staging you'll need the vault passphrase, which is appended just below.

recovery phrase for yafof-tajof: julmir-kelax-julvan-holath-belvan-holir-ralael-ralvan-ralath-julvan-silmir-istmir-kaswyn-ulamir

**Q: How does Ladlewise protect its scaling-factor config during a security review?**

Good question — the recipe-scaling math in Ladlewise is boring, but the config store isn't. It's sealed at rest, and reviewers get a read-only unseal path with full audit logging. To open the reviewer session, enter the recovery passphrase shown below.

vault phrase of hawif-bahof = novvan-belius-istael-fenvan-holdor-druox-eliath

Runbook: Scanline barcode bridge

If warehouse scans stop flowing into Cartwheel, it's almost always the bridge service on the Dunmore floor box wedging after a USB hiccup. Bounce the service first — nine times out of ten that fixes it. If not, check the queue depth before escalating. When restarting, make sure the bridge comes up with these settings.

deployment values, yafop-bajef:
[gilok]
team = ulaius
access_code = ac_423664
host = gilok.sivrelhq.corp
port = 9200
owner = pelius.istax
peer = eliok.torvasoft.internal

**14:22 — Tide widget goes sideways**

Around 14:22 the Shorefinch tide-table widget started showing low tide times shifted by six hours for the Melbury Cove region. Users noticed fast (lots of confused boaters). Root cause was a timezone fallback in the 14:05 deploy. We rolled back at 14:40 and tides were sane again by 14:45. The rolled-back build's trace token is noted below.

trace token, fafog-kageg: htk4_98e6

## Step 4: Update rate limit handling

Gatekeep v3 enforces per-plugin quotas at the gateway, not in your plugin. Remove any local throttling; it now causes double penalties. On a 429, honor the retry header exactly. Quotas reset per minute, not per hour. Your plugin manifest must declare the following values:

deployment values, kahof-yadug:
[gorys]
team = silael
access_code = ac_00d620
owner = istox.oliys
host = gorys.torvastack.example
port = 9000
peer = holmir.merlaqsoft.example
salt = 9fdae78a
pin = 2358